阿里云的应用镜像和系统镜像是两种不同的云服务器(ECS)镜像类型,主要区别在于预装内容和适用场景:
1. 系统镜像
- 定义:仅包含纯净的操作系统(如Windows Server、CentOS、Ubuntu等),不预装其他软件。
- 特点:
- 纯净环境:仅提供基础操作系统,用户需自行部署应用环境(如Web服务器、数据库等)。
- 灵活性高:适合需要完全自定义配置的用户。
- 手动配置:需手动安装应用、依赖和优化系统。
- 适用场景:
- 开发者或运维人员熟悉环境搭建。
- 需要高度定制化或特殊配置的场景。
- 测试或学习操作系统本身。
2. 应用镜像
- 定义:在操作系统基础上预装了特定应用(如WordPress、LAMP、Node.js等)及依赖环境。
- 特点:
- 开箱即用:一键部署后即可直接使用预装应用,节省配置时间。
- 集成优化:环境(如PHP版本、数据库)已针对应用优化,减少兼容性问题。
- 快速上手:适合不熟悉底层配置的用户。
- 适用场景:
- 快速搭建网站、博客、电商平台(如WordPress、Magento)。
- 需要即用型开发环境(如Node.js、Python)。
- 缺乏运维经验的小型企业或个人用户。
核心对比
| 对比项 | 系统镜像 | 应用镜像 |
|---|---|---|
| 内容 | 仅操作系统 | 操作系统 + 预装应用及环境 |
| 配置复杂度 | 高(需手动部署) | 低(一键部署) |
| 灵活性 | 高(完全自定义) | 较低(依赖预装配置) |
| 适用人群 | 技术人员 | 非技术人员或快速部署需求 |
选择建议
- 选系统镜像:需完全控制环境或学习系统管理。
- 选应用镜像:希望快速上线应用,避免配置麻烦。
阿里云还提供自定义镜像功能,允许用户基于现有实例创建个性化镜像,满足混合需求。
云服务器